1.1 Engineeringtoolbox
Website Location and Availability Web Page: http://www.engineeringtoolbox.com/

Description: This is a great website to get quick information regarding all the subjects that cover in engineering program. Students will be able to find quick and brief information about the subject they are inquiring about. Using of this website is every easy and simple. After entering into the website, student see different subject matter with it brief description on the homepage or left hand side of the website. Few broad subjects have sub-subject within it. If the student is unable to find the subject he/she is looking for then he/she can use the search tab on to find the information. In addition, this website is great for providing conversion between units such as from Metric to English and vice verse. Since as engineering student, most of the time converting units is very important. This website is very helpful when students taking Thermodynamic (ME 300) class.

Tips: After entering the website, readers have many options to obtain information that the reader is looking within this particular website. 1. Use the search engine if you know exactly what you are looking for. 2. If unsure about specific subject, choose a broad category that relate to the subject then choose chose a subject within it. 3. For fastest was of finding information about this website is to do a Google search with the website name include in the search.

1.4 American Society of Mechanical Engineers


Website Location and Availability Web Page: https://www.asme.org/ Description: American Society of Mechanical Engineers (ASME) is a not for profit engineering society for mechanical engineering students. ASME is a globally recognized organization. ASME plays an important role in set standard for every aspect of manufacturing product. ASME work very closely with government to set standard. In addition, it also provides most current research information in different industries, which will help Mechanical Engineering students. Also undergraduate Mechanical Engineering students can join ASME. ASME holds conference and event for different topics where students have opportunity to learn more about his/her passion and networking with others with same passion. In fact Penn State is part of ASME since it has an AMSE chapter that affiliated with global AMSE.

Tips: 1. Use the four tabs on home page to find what you are looking for 2. If looking for job it is under the Networking tabs 3. Topic tab bring different subject matter that reader can choose from to read about

Engineering village
Database Location and Availability Web Page: http://www.engineeringvillage.com.ezaccess.libraries.psu.edu/search/quick.url

Description: This is great place to article regarding current information. Students that are doing research in mechanical engineering department can take great advantage of this journal database search engine. This database added new material regarding engineering material every week. This is a great place to obtain information since most of the material has to pass to peer-review. There is many ways a student can search information at this database such as by: Subject/Title, Abstract, Author, Author Affiliation, ISBN, and etc. Student can enter more information in different search bar, which will narrow down the search result.

Tips: 1. Use specific and multiple words in different search tab to narrow the search result. 2. Use a word with question mark at end to find more result 3. Search by author or article title if known, to find information faster

U.S. Government Publications


Catalog Location and Availability Web page: http://purl.fdlp.gov/GPO/gpo41328 Description: The Catalog of U.S. Government Publications contain valuable online and print publication information from legislative, executive, and judicial branches of the U.S. government since 1976 and will contain more data from 1800s. The information provided by the website can also be found at a local library such as Penn State University Library. The website contain research article that was funded by the government. It also contains all the Bills that have been passed by all three branches of U.S. government. Students will be able to use this website to find out information when he/she is doing a capstone project in senior year. In addition students will be able to find Bills pass by government to see how student design might be affect by a bill. There is three ways students can find information such as using Basic, Advance, or Expert search tool. Tips: 1. Each search tool provides tips about bottom of the page about how to use the search tool effectively. 2. Using advance search use question mark at end of the word and use multiple words in different search tab to find information faster. 3. Using expert search tool, reader must know few common abbreviation word such as: WRD for word, WRD Words, WTI for Words in title field, WAU for Words in author field, WPU - Words in publisher field, and many more
